Blumhouse Productions have acquired, on spec, the latest project from Sean Finegan and Gregg Maxwell Parker. The same duo that scripted ‘Getaway‘, the 2013 thriller that starred Ethan Hawke, Selena Gomez and Jon Voight and featured a Shelby Super Snake Mustang, driven by Hawke at breakneck speeds and wrecked so many cars that a junkyard was set up on scene just to repair vehicles. ‘Free Fall‘ won’t have the vehicular overhead ‘Getaway‘ required, the scares and thrills will be achieved by different means.

GSN Orders Episodes Of ‘Hellevator’ Featuring Twisted Twins!!!
Hey guys, Jana here,
More Blumhouse Productions news today, this time it’s coming in the form of a game show. GSN has given the go sign for a horror-themed game show called Hellevator and have ordered eight episodes. The show will be produced through a combined effort by Matador and Blumhouse Prods in association with Lionsgate TV. Executive producers are Jason Blum, Jay Peterson and Todd Lubin.

Indie Horror Film ‘Creep’ With Mark Duplass Is Getting A Wide Release!!
Hello, Jana here,
Festival season is always a great atmosphere to learn about a new band, artist or film. It can also be a great place for those independent film makers to find a distributing partner that will generate a bigger spotlight on their work. This is the case for the indie horror film ‘Creep‘. This low-budget thriller stars Patrick Brice as a videographer who answers an Craigslist ad to film a stranger (Mark Duplass) in a remote mountain town for a personal project that brings to light that the client is not at all what he initially seemed, with sinister repercussions.
